Q: Does the Coppervane metrics sidecar need its own release approval?

Yes. The sidecar ships independently of the main service but is version-pinned per environment, so a release without an updated pin does nothing. Bump the pin in the deploy manifest, verify aggregation lag stays under 30s in staging, then promote. Rollbacks are pin reverts — no redeploy of the host service needed. The approval checklist and current pin matrix are on the release page.

wiki page, tahaf-tajog: https://jira.ordindyn.corp/pipeline

## Profile Store Sharding — Limits

Norrbin's user-profile store shards by hashed account key across fixed virtual buckets. Do not add shards ad hoc; rebalancing is operator-driven. Per-shard row counts, write rates, and hot-key thresholds are enforced by the gatekeeper and will reject writes past the caps. Current limits are defined in code as follows.

tuning constants:
QUOTAS = {
    "druwyn": 5,
    "holix": 5,
    "zorath": 5,
    "holwyn": 10,
}

Handover – night shift, from Dara to Velt. The new fourth floor at Brindlemore House opens tomorrow morning. Cleaners finished tonight; lights on a motion timer, so don't log faults if they cut out. Lift access to level four is live but the stairwell door stays locked until 06:00. If security asks, the opening notice is pinned in the kitchen. Use the following pass for the stairwell door.

turnstile pass: bdg-PD-2

## Deployment

The Verafold validator plugin host deploys as a single container behind the Marstow ingress. Plugins are discovered from the mounted registry volume at startup; a restart is required to pick up new validator bundles. Health checks hit the loader endpoint and fail if any declared plugin is missing or version-mismatched. Future maintainers should note that staging and production differ only in their configuration, not in code. The values the production instance currently runs with are reproduced below.

deployment values, yadug-bawif:
[framir]
team = pelox
access_code = ac_a38ab2
owner = tamion.julael
host = framir.tolvaqlabs.test
port = 11211
peer = tammir.zemvargrid.local
salt = 2215ef03
pin = 1541